For well over a decade, the edible holiday displays at Walt Disney World have filled the foyers of some of their best loved resorts with the spice heavy scent of freshly baked gingerbread. This being our first Christmas in the Orlando area, we have never been able to view these works of art in person until this week. I have seen photos of them online for years, but now that we were actually able to go and see them, I can see what everyone makes such a fuss about. Loving Husband is a trained pastry chef, Teams of Disney pastry chefs work for months baking, detailing and assembling these life-size gingerbread sculptures. If you live near WDW, or will be here between late November to the beginning of January, I strongly encourage you to spend a little time exploring these exhibits.

The first stop on our self guided tour was the largest, and in my opinion, the most impressive baked creation, is the the gingerbread house in the first floor main lobby of the Grand Floridian Resort. The house fits perfectly into the ornate Victorian design scheme of this hotel. This piece is so huge that there is a store with real live people inside of it selling souvenirs of the annual event, as well as edible shingles just like those that adorn the roof of the structure (below).
